黑狐家游戏

多元管理运维平台有哪些组成的,多元管理运维平台有哪些组成

欧气 3 0

标题:探索多元管理运维平台的关键组成部分

本文详细探讨了多元管理运维平台的组成部分,包括监控系统、自动化工具、日志管理、配置管理、安全管理以及性能优化等,通过对这些组成部分的深入分析,揭示了它们在保障系统稳定运行、提高效率和提升用户体验方面的重要作用。

一、引言

在当今数字化时代,企业和组织依赖于复杂的信息技术系统来支持业务运营,这些系统的高效运行对于业务的连续性和成功至关重要,多元管理运维平台作为一种综合性的解决方案,旨在整合和管理各种运维任务和流程,以确保系统的稳定性、可靠性和性能,本文将深入探讨多元管理运维平台的组成部分,帮助读者更好地理解其架构和功能。

二、监控系统

监控系统是多元管理运维平台的核心组成部分之一,它负责实时监测系统的各种指标,如 CPU 使用率、内存使用率、网络流量等,以及应用程序的性能和状态,通过监控系统,运维人员可以及时发现系统中的异常情况,并采取相应的措施进行处理,以避免故障的发生,监控系统通常包括以下几个方面:

1、指标采集:监控系统需要从被监控的系统中采集各种指标数据,这些数据可以通过传感器、代理程序或直接从系统的日志文件中获取。

2、数据存储:采集到的指标数据需要进行存储,以便后续的分析和查询,监控系统通常使用数据库来存储数据,并提供数据备份和恢复功能。

3、数据分析:监控系统需要对采集到的数据进行分析,以发现系统中的异常情况和趋势,数据分析可以使用各种算法和工具,如统计分析、机器学习等。

4、告警机制:当监控系统发现系统中的异常情况时,需要及时向运维人员发送告警信息,告警机制可以包括邮件、短信、即时通讯等多种方式,以确保运维人员能够及时收到告警信息。

三、自动化工具

自动化工具是多元管理运维平台的另一个重要组成部分,它可以帮助运维人员自动化执行各种运维任务,如部署、配置、备份、恢复等,从而提高运维效率和减少人为错误,自动化工具通常包括以下几个方面:

1、配置管理工具:配置管理工具可以帮助运维人员管理系统的配置信息,如服务器的 IP 地址、端口号、用户名、密码等,配置管理工具可以提供可视化的界面,方便运维人员进行配置管理。

2、部署工具:部署工具可以帮助运维人员自动化部署应用程序和服务,部署工具可以提供模板化的部署流程,方便运维人员进行部署操作。

3、备份工具:备份工具可以帮助运维人员定期备份系统的数据和配置信息,备份工具可以提供多种备份方式,如本地备份、异地备份、磁带备份等,以确保数据的安全性。

4、恢复工具:恢复工具可以帮助运维人员在系统出现故障时快速恢复系统的数据和配置信息,恢复工具可以提供自动化的恢复流程,方便运维人员进行恢复操作。

四、日志管理

日志管理是多元管理运维平台的重要组成部分之一,它负责收集、存储、分析和查询系统的日志信息,以帮助运维人员了解系统的运行情况和故障原因,日志管理通常包括以下几个方面:

1、日志采集:日志管理需要从被监控的系统中采集各种日志信息,这些日志信息可以通过传感器、代理程序或直接从系统的日志文件中获取。

2、数据存储:采集到的日志信息需要进行存储,以便后续的分析和查询,日志管理通常使用数据库来存储数据,并提供数据备份和恢复功能。

3、数据分析:日志管理需要对采集到的数据进行分析,以发现系统中的异常情况和趋势,数据分析可以使用各种算法和工具,如统计分析、机器学习等。

4、查询和检索:日志管理需要提供查询和检索功能,以便运维人员能够快速找到所需的日志信息,查询和检索功能可以使用各种查询语言和工具,如 SQL、Elasticsearch 等。

五、配置管理

配置管理是多元管理运维平台的重要组成部分之一,它负责管理系统的配置信息,如服务器的 IP 地址、端口号、用户名、密码等,配置管理通常包括以下几个方面:

1、配置项管理:配置管理需要对系统的配置项进行管理,如服务器的 IP 地址、端口号、用户名、密码等,配置项管理可以提供可视化的界面,方便运维人员进行配置项管理。

2、配置版本控制:配置管理需要对系统的配置版本进行控制,以确保配置信息的一致性和可追溯性,配置版本控制可以使用版本控制系统,如 Git、SVN 等。

3、配置审批:配置管理需要对系统的配置变更进行审批,以确保配置变更的合理性和安全性,配置审批可以使用工作流引擎,如 Activiti、JBoss BPMS 等。

4、配置发布:配置管理需要对系统的配置变更进行发布,以确保配置变更能够及时生效,配置发布可以使用自动化工具,如 Ansible、Puppet 等。

六、安全管理

安全管理是多元管理运维平台的重要组成部分之一,它负责保障系统的安全性,防止未经授权的访问、篡改和破坏,安全管理通常包括以下几个方面:

1、用户认证和授权:安全管理需要对用户进行认证和授权,以确保只有合法用户能够访问系统,用户认证和授权可以使用身份验证技术,如用户名/密码、数字证书、生物识别等。

2、访问控制:安全管理需要对用户的访问进行控制,以确保用户只能访问其被授权的资源,访问控制可以使用访问控制列表、角色-based access control 等技术。

3、数据加密:安全管理需要对系统的数据进行加密,以确保数据的机密性和完整性,数据加密可以使用对称加密、非对称加密等技术。

4、安全审计:安全管理需要对系统的安全事件进行审计,以发现安全漏洞和安全威胁,安全审计可以使用安全审计工具,如 Nessus、OpenVAS 等。

七、性能优化

性能优化是多元管理运维平台的重要组成部分之一,它负责优化系统的性能,提高系统的响应速度和吞吐量,性能优化通常包括以下几个方面:

1、系统调优:性能优化需要对系统的参数进行调优,以提高系统的性能,系统调优可以包括调整操作系统的参数、数据库的参数、应用程序的参数等。

2、缓存优化:性能优化需要对系统的缓存进行优化,以提高系统的响应速度,缓存优化可以包括使用缓存服务器、优化缓存算法等。

3、数据库优化:性能优化需要对数据库进行优化,以提高数据库的性能,数据库优化可以包括优化数据库的结构、索引、查询语句等。

4、应用程序优化:性能优化需要对应用程序进行优化,以提高应用程序的性能,应用程序优化可以包括优化算法、代码结构、数据库交互等。

八、结论

多元管理运维平台是一种综合性的解决方案,它可以帮助企业和组织更好地管理和维护其信息技术系统,通过整合监控系统、自动化工具、日志管理、配置管理、安全管理和性能优化等组成部分,多元管理运维平台可以提高运维效率、降低运维成本、提高系统的稳定性和可靠性,从而为企业和组织的业务发展提供有力的支持。

标签: #多元管理 #运维平台 #组成部分 #功能模块

黑狐家游戏
  • 评论列表

留言评论